# Kepler-33

![Kepler-33](https://i.imgur.com/zVvzBrOl.png)

True 40% keyboard. The simple and symmetric.

* Keyboard Maintainer: [Yaya](https://github.com/seityaya)
* Hardware Supported: Kepler-33/proto, STM32F401
* Hardware Availability: *[Telegram](https://t.me/seityaya)*
* Keyboard Layout Editor: [Kepler-33](http://www.keyboard-layout-editor.com/#/gists/a456c2256174a2cfa0b4aea832e78d8e)

Make example for this keyboard (after setting up your build environment):

    make kepler_33/proto:default

Flashing example for this keyboard:

    make kepler_33/proto:default:flash

See the [build environment setup](https://docs.qmk.fm/#/getting_started_build_tools) and the [make instructions](https://docs.qmk.fm/#/getting_started_make_guide) for more information. Brand new to QMK? Start with our [Complete Newbs Guide](https://docs.qmk.fm/#/newbs).

## Bootloader

Enter the bootloader in 1 ways:

* **Physical reset button**: Briefly press the button on the back of the PCB - some may have pads you must short instead

# IIDX Synth Labs Solo Layout

This keymap is intended for usage as a gamepad for [beatmania IIDX INFINITAS](https://p.eagate.573.jp/game/infinitas/2/index.html).

This keycap follows the default keymapping for the game, shown here:

![Default Keymapping Settings Screen](https://i.imgur.com/Va48FnZ.png)

The face buttons correspond directly to ボタン 1 - ボタン 7

Turning the knob clockwise corresponds to スクラッチ-右回転
Turning the knob counter-clockwise corresponds to スクラッチ-左回転

While holding down the knob button
* The bottom row of face buttons corresponds to ボタン E1 - ボタン E4
* The top-left and top-right face buttons correspond to ボタン 1 and ボタン 2, for adjustment of in-game scroll speed
